Viro React:构建AR/VR体验的强大平台
viro ViroReact: AR and VR using React Native 项目地址: https://gitcode.com/gh_mirrors/vi/viro
项目介绍
Viro React 是一个专为开发者设计的平台,旨在快速构建增强现实(AR)和虚拟现实(VR)体验。开发者可以使用 React Native 编写代码,Viro React 则能够将这些代码原生运行在所有移动 VR 和 AR 平台上,包括 Google Daydream、Samsung Gear VR、Google Cardboard(适用于 iOS 和 Android)、iOS ARKit 和 Android ARCore。Viro React 不仅支持多种平台,还提供了丰富的示例项目和详细的文档,帮助开发者快速上手。
项目技术分析
Viro React 的核心技术基于 React Native,这意味着开发者可以使用熟悉的 JavaScript 和 React 语法来构建 AR/VR 应用。Viro React 通过其高效的渲染引擎,能够将开发者的代码无缝转换为原生 AR/VR 体验。此外,Viro React 还支持 CI/CD 流程,开发者可以通过 GitHub Actions 获取最新的构建版本,确保项目的稳定性和持续集成。
项目及技术应用场景
Viro React 的应用场景非常广泛,包括但不限于:
- 教育培训:通过 AR/VR 技术,学生可以身临其境地体验历史事件或科学实验,提升学习效果。
- 房地产:购房者可以通过 VR 技术在家中浏览房产,节省时间和成本。
- 零售:消费者可以通过 AR 技术在购买前预览商品的实际效果,如家具摆放、服装试穿等。
- 娱乐:开发者可以利用 Viro React 创建沉浸式的游戏和娱乐应用,提供全新的用户体验。
项目特点
- 跨平台支持:Viro React 支持多种 AR/VR 平台,开发者只需编写一次代码,即可在多个设备上运行。
- 开源免费:Viro React 是一个开源项目,开发者可以免费使用,并且没有任何分发限制。
- 丰富的示例项目:项目中包含了多个示例项目,涵盖了从基础的 360 照片展示到复杂的 AR 应用,帮助开发者快速学习和上手。
- 持续集成与交付:通过 GitHub Actions,开发者可以轻松获取最新的构建版本,确保项目的稳定性和持续集成。
- 强大的社区支持:Viro React 拥有活跃的开发者社区,开发者可以在社区中获取帮助、分享经验,并参与项目的改进。
结语
Viro React 为开发者提供了一个强大且灵活的平台,帮助他们快速构建高质量的 AR/VR 应用。无论你是初学者还是经验丰富的开发者,Viro React 都能为你提供所需的支持和工具。立即加入 Viro React 的行列,开启你的 AR/VR 开发之旅吧!
了解更多信息:
viro ViroReact: AR and VR using React Native 项目地址: https://gitcode.com/gh_mirrors/vi/viro
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考